Elastic optical network based resource distribution method in virtual network mapping

A technology of virtual network mapping and elastic optical network, applied in the field of communication, can solve the problems of large link resources, high blocking rate, not considering physical network load, etc., and achieve the effect of optimizing physical network link resources and small blocking rate

Active Publication Date: 2016-09-28
XIDIAN UNIV
View PDF3 Cites 14 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The disadvantage of this method is that the method performs a mapping of the virtual network mapping once, resulting in a high blocking rate; because the selection of the virtual network link path does not consider the node resources, resulting in misjudgment of the impact, which also causes the virtual network mapping blocking rate higher
The disadvantage of this method is that the mapping of the virtual network does not consider the load of the physical network, which will cause the allocation of mapping resources to be concentrated locally and the virtual network to occupy a large amount of physical network link resources.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Elastic optical network based resource distribution method in virtual network mapping
  • Elastic optical network based resource distribution method in virtual network mapping
  • Elastic optical network based resource distribution method in virtual network mapping

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0044] The present invention will be described in further detail below in conjunction with the accompanying drawings.

[0045] Refer to attached figure 1 , the specific steps of the present invention are described as follows.

[0046] Step 1, constitute a virtual network.

[0047] Through the controller of the SDN network architecture, the computing resources and communication bandwidth required by the service request are obtained to form a virtual network.

[0048] Step 2, overall initialization.

[0049] Initialize the pheromone matrix as an m×n matrix of all 1s, where m represents the number of virtual network nodes, and n represents the number of physical network nodes.

[0050] Initialize the ant algebra to a constant value of 100.

[0051] Step 3, local initialization.

[0052] The number of ants in each generation of ants is initialized to a constant value of 50, and the taboo table taboo is initialized to a 1×n matrix of all 1s, where n represents the number of ph...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ides an elastic optical network based resource distribution method in virtual network mapping and mainly solves a problem of resource distribution based on an electric optical network in virtual network mapping. The specific steps include: 1, forming a virtual network; 2, performing general initiation; 3, performing local initiation; 4, mapping virtual network nodes; 5, calculating virtual network node fitness; 6, recording a mapping result; 7, judging whether the number of ants of each generation is 0 or not; 8, updating an information prime matrix; 9, judging whether the ant generation number is 0 or not; 10, obtaining a final mapping result of the virtual network nodes; 11, mapping a virtual network link. According to the invention, by adopting an adaptive method and a continuous contiguity method, influence on physical network nodes by the virtual network link is evaluated comprehensively, network mapping jam rate and the amount of physical network link resource occupied by the virtual network are reduced, and physical network link load balance is improved.

Description

technical field [0001] The invention belongs to the technical field of communication, and further relates to a resource allocation method based on an elastic optical network in virtual network mapping in the technical field of wired communication. The present invention can be applied in the elastic optical network of the data center to allocate resources in the elastic optical network of the data center for virtual network requests. Background technique [0002] In recent years, the Internet's demand for bandwidth has greatly promoted the development of high-bandwidth, scalable communication and network technologies. The high bandwidth capacity of the optical fiber communication network has been highly valued by the academic and industrial circles, and is considered to be an important part of the core and backbone network in the future network system. However, the existing optical communication technology can only achieve relatively rough allocation and scheduling of optica...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H04L12/24
CPCH04L41/00H04L41/5051
Inventor 王波王琨顾华玺杨如莹魏雯婷詹政
Owner XIDIAN U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products